Ticket: ADMIN-2290

Hey — the bulk-edit button in the Larchpool admin table is throwing 502s on staging because the batch service was stood up without its env fully filled in. Single-row edits work fine, which is why nobody noticed. Fix is quick: open the batch service env file and add the following line.

sealed setting: ARCHIVE_KEY3=8d0

Runbook: Account recovery during Plover shard migration

While user-profile shards are being split, recovery requests must route to the shard map in Brindle, not the legacy lookup. Reviewers: confirm the fallback path is disabled before approving. If the shard map itself is unreachable, unlock the standby map using the passphrase below.

strongbox words: prawyn-fenmir

## Service Account: reminder-runner

The clinic appointment reminder job at Larkvale Health runs nightly under the `svc-reminders` account. It reads tomorrow's schedule from the booking service, renders message templates, and hands them to the notification gateway. New team members: never run it manually against production data.

The job authenticates to the notification gateway using the key below.

app token of yahif-fahap = vxb3-3pr

Welcome aboard! During your first week at Tillbrook Systems, you'll technically count as a visitor, so a few ground rules apply. Sign in at the Aldermere Court lobby each morning and wear your visitor lanyard where folks can see it. Someone from your team should walk you between floors until your permanent badge is sorted — usually by Friday. If you need the kitchenette or the third-floor workrooms before then, that's fine, just don't prop doors open. For the interim period, use the door code below.

staff pass of kawip-hawef = bdg-QLP-2